Gold prices have edged lower, nearing the $4,100 level, amid renewed US-Iran tensions. The price movement is attributed to safe-haven demand, although some reports suggest the selling may be nearly exhausted. The outlook for gold remains uncertain, with factors such as inflation, Fed policy, and geopolitics potentially influencing its direction.
